Mrs. Seeley, of Beacon, 79

Mrs. Michael A. Seeley, 79, formerly of 61 Kent St., Beacon, died Wednesday in Millbrook after a long illness.

The former Edna Crusie, she was born in Dutchess Junction, Jan. 4, 1889, the daughter of the late William and Mildred (Slapp) Crusie. She was a communicant of St. John’s Church, Beacon.

In addition to her husband, Mrs. Seeley is survived by a son, Michael A. Seeley Jr.; two daughters, Mrs. Michael (Loretta) Slinsky and Mrs. Philip (Helen) Mattracion, all of Beacon: two brothers, Fred, San Diego, Calif.; and James Crusie, Nanuel: two sisters, Mrs. Minnie Owens, Hopewell Junction: and Mrs. Hazel Burroughs, Albany; several nieces and nephews; 11 grandchildren, and nine great-grandchildren.

The funeral will be Saturday at 9:15 a.m. from the Halvey Funeral Home, 24 Willow St.

Published in the Poughkeepsie Journal, Thursday, December 19, 1968 page 38
